Carl Ewald Tacke, 92, was called to rest with Christ and died peacefully on February 26, 2026.
Born on April 24,1933, in Big Bend, Wisconsin. Carl was the son of Reverend Ewald and Florence (Hermann) Tacke. He was a graduate of Northwestern College Preparatory High School in Watertown, Wisconsin where his father was an instructor. Carl was a graduate of Art Center College of Design in California. Afterwards, he worked for a brief period in Chicago. For the majority of his career, he worked at Pontiac Motor Division - Design Staff at General Motors Tech Center in Warren, Michigan. Carl was an avid gardener and loved to work on various home improvement projects in his meticulously designed workshop. He was known for his storytelling and would often recount memories of growing up in rural Wisconsin during the WWII era as well his years of working with GM Design Staff. His positive demeanor, genuine kindness, and sense of humor endeared and touched all.
Carl did enjoy some travel. In the 1970s and 1980s he loved taking road trips with his family to tent-camp across the USA. Interested in WWII, Carl traveled to Europe in 1996 and saw the D-Day beaches in Normandy, as well as other WWII sites in Belgium, Germany and Italy. After retiring from GM, he enjoyed traveling with his wife, especially to the National Parks. From 2000 to 2022, he and his wife Ellie lived in the Traverse City area; together, they enjoyed hosting friends and family on Green Lake. He was active in various home improvement projects as well as his continual interest in gardening. In his later years, he returned to the Detroit area. He was an ever-loving husband and caretaker to his dear wife, Ellie.
He is survived by his loving family: daughter Lisa (Mark) Tacke-Pucylowski; son Paul (Susan) Tacke; and grandchildren, Olivia Pucylowski and Trent Tacke. He was preceded in death by his wife Eleanor (Ellie) Tacke (Atherton), his sister, Ruth (Arnold) Doreau, and brother, Harold Tacke.
